colfen
Welsh
Etymology
Uncertain; probably related to Old Irish colba (“platform; pillar”) and possibly derived from Latin columen.
Pronunciation
- IPA(key): /ˈkɔlvɛn/
Noun
colfen f (plural colfenni or colfennau)
